I am a former actuary currently getting teacher certified in PA so that I can become a high school math teacher. I graduated magna cum laude from the State University of New York at Albany with a B.S. in Actuarial Science and minors in both English and Computer Science. Additionally, I was a National Merit Scholarship winner after scoring 1560 on my SAT (800 math, 760 verbal).

I have several years of experience tutoring math and helping students prepare for standardized tests (SAT, ACT, and LSAT) with excellent results. I can comfortably handle the material from any high school mathematics course, from pre-algebra through Calculus B/C, as well as any material covered in the SAT, ACT, or LSAT. I can also handle the content of a wide variety of undergraduate math courses --- particularly probability and statistics, where Ive had great success helping students struggling with that material.

I am very good at establishing rapport with students and creating an environment in which they are comfortable asking questions and being honest with me when they are confused --- which is CRUCIAL to the success of any tutor. I also have multiple methods to present all mathematical topics, so I can nearly always find an approach that makes sense to students that have struggled with the "standard" mathematics presentation.

In addition to providing excellent academic lessons, I am also able to teach students quick and easy methods to evaluate the reasonableness of their answers and various methods to help them catch their arithmetic mistakes. Additionally, I do my best to ensure that my students have a conceptual understanding of whatever topic I'm presenting rather than simply teaching the process to solve a certain type of math question. Process-based instruction has its place and can be valuable in some cases, but that type of preparation generally does not enable students to handle question types that they haven't seen before.

Finally, I am a Director of the Daniel Boone Area School District School District and the Chair of the DBASD Curriculum & Instruction Committee, so I am confident that I am keeping up with the trends/challenges facing today's students.

I had a successful professional career, but it is now time for me to give back to the community in the best way am able: improving the achievement and self-confidence of PA students, our future leaders.
